The Department of Mineral Resources and Energy (DMRE) is facilitating full time bursaries for the academic year 2022. The bursary is targeting eligible South African scholars from disadvantaged social backgrounds currently doing or have completed grade 12. The bursary recipients should be studying towards mining and energy related fields preferably in the following disciplines:
- Bachelor of Science (Physics)
- Chemical Engineering (Mineral Processing)
- Electrical Engineering (Heavy Current)
- Electro-Mechanical Engineering
- Environmental Health and Management
- Geology
- Industrial Engineering
- Mechanical Engineering
- Metallurgical Engineering (Extractive)
- Mining Engineering
- Mining Survey
- Rock Engineering
PLEASE TAKE NOTE OF THE FOLLOWING
1. Criteria & Instructions as outlined in the application form
2. 2022 Bursary application forms can be downloaded from www.dmre.gov.za
3. Submit application form with attachments to: The Director: Ms. Nondumiso Zulu, The Department of Mineral Resources & Energy Trevenna Campus, 70 Meintjies Street, Sunnyside, OR post before the closing date to Private Bag X59, Arcadia, 0007 or Email to GirlLearnerBursary@dmre.gov.za. For any enquiries call Ms. Morongwe Madisha on (012) 444 3860 and Ms. Olga Sedibe (012) 444 3309
4. Old and altered bursary application forms will lead to automatic disqualification.
5. Closing date for the applications is 30 November 2021. Should you NOT be contacted on or before the 31 January 2022 consider your application to be unsuccessful.
6. First preference will be given to female applicants. Youth with disabilities are encouraged to apply.
